SURFICIALDEPOSITSQgGravel,sand,andsilt(HoloceneandPleistocene)—Alluviumpediments;includessomecolluviumandsoils.
Depositsmostlylight-gray,unindurated,andofpoorlyroundedandlocally-derivedclasts,exceptalonglargervalley-centerrivers.
Mostlyseveralmetersthickbutasmuchasahundredmetersthick.
QdSandandsilt(Holocene)—Eoliandeposits,mainlyofdunesbutincludingbeachridgesreworkedintodunes.
Unitisprobablyasmuchasseveralmetersthickinmostplaces.
QpGravel,sand,silt,andclay(Pleistocene)—Pluviallakedeposits,includingbeachgravelinlowridges.
Depositswellsortedandmostlyunconsolidated;gravelwellrounded.
Thicknessunknown.
QTgGravel,sand,andsilt(PleistoceneandPliocene)—Mainlyalluviumofbasins;includessomecolluviumandlandslidedeposits.
Generallylight-pinkishgray,weaklyindurated,andwithpoorlyroundedclasts;locallywellindurated.
Thicknessseveralmeterstohundredsofmeters.
QTguGravel,sand,andsilt(HolocenetoMiocene)—Alluviumoffloodplains,terraces,pediments,andbasins,undifferentiated.
Commonlyafewtensofmeterstohundredsofmetersthick.
QTbBasalt(PleistocenetoPliocene)—Lavaflows,pyroclasticrocks,andsomeintercalatedgravel.
Thicknessseveralmeterstoafewhundredmetersinmostplaces.
Radiometricallydatedat0.
25,1.
0,and3.
2m.
y.
oldTucUpperconglomerate,gravel,andsand(PlioceneandMiocene)—Alluvium;mainlydepositsrichinvolcanicfragmentsderivedfromunderlyingornearbyrhyoliterocks.
Thicknessseveraltensofmeterstohundredsofmeters.
IGNEOUSANDSEDIMENTARYROCKSTbBasalt(Miocene)—Lavaflows,pyroclasticrocks,andsomedikesandintercalatedgravel,ofandesiticbasalt.
Mostlyabout1metertoseveralmetersthick.
Includesayoungergroupradiometricallydatedat13and14m.
y.
old,andanoldergroupdatedat20,23,24,25,and25m.
y.
TcConglomerate(MiocenetoEocene)—Mostlyreddish-graypoorlyinduratedtomoderatelyinduratedrockwithsubroundedclasts;locallyincludessome6landslidedeposits,andsomebodiesoftuffandcoarselyporphyriticandesitetoosmalltobemappedseparately.
Commonlyseveraltenstohundredsofmetersthick.
TvaExtrusiveandesiteanddacite(MioceneandupperOligocene)—Lavaflows,pyroclasticrocks,someintercalatedepiclasticrocks,anddikes.
Mostlygray,fine-grained,porphyriticrocks;includessomeverycoarsefeldsparporphyryandesite(Turkeytrackporphyry,aninformaltermofCooper,1961).
Thicknessmostlyseveralmeterstoseveraltensofmeters.
Datedat24,25,27,33,and39m.
y.
TvExtrusiverhyoliteandrhyodacite(MioceneandupperOligocene)—Lavaflows,weldedtuff,pyroclasticrocks,andsomeintercalatedepiclasticrocks.
Light-graytograyish-pink,vitrictofine-grained,porphyritic.
Commonlyafewtenstoafewthousandsofmetersthick.
Datedat23,24,25,26,26,26,26,and27m.
y.
Anadditionaldateof47m.
y.
,ifsubstantiated,mayindicatethepresenceofEocenerocksinthelowermemberoftheSOVolcanicsofCochiseCo.
TugGranitoidrocks(MioceneandupperOligocene)—Granite(),quartzmonzonite,andgranodioriteinstocksandsmallintrusivebodies.
Datedat22(),26,28,29,30,31,31,and33m.
y.
TiIntrusiverhyoliteandrhyodacite(upperOligocene)—Plugs,laccoliths,anddikes;probablygeneticallyrelatedtovolcanicrocksnearby.
Mostlygraytopink,vitrictofine-grained,porphyritic,massivetoflow-laminated.
Datedat24,25,26,26,26,27,and29m.
y.
TaAndesite(OligoceneandEocene)—Lavaflows,pyroclasticrocks,andepiclasticrocks.
Mainlygreenish-graypropylitizedpyroxene-oramphibole-bearingfeldsparporphyries.
TlcLowerconglomerate,gravel,andsand(OligoceneandEocene)—Alluvium;commonlygrayish-reddepositsofsmall,wellrounded,nonvolcanicclasts.
Mostlyseveralmeterstoafewtensofmetersthick.
CORDILLERAN(LARAMIDE)IGNEOUSANDSEDIMENTARYROCKSTgGranitoidrocks(upperPaleocene)—Mostlyquartzmonzoniteandgranodioritestocksandsomequartzdioritestocks.
Includessomeaphaniticporphyries.
Datedat47(),51,51,52,54,54,60,and60m.
y.
TlpQuartzlatiteporphyry(upperPaleocene)—Plugs,brecciapipes,anddikes.
Inmanyplacesassociatedwithmineralization.
Datedat56,56,and56m.
y.
TlvLowervolcanicrocks(lowerPaleocene)—Rhyolitetoandesitelavaflows,pyroclasticrocks,andsomeintercalatedepiclasticrocks.
Datedat57m.
y.
Possiblyyoungeragetoeast.
7TlgLowergranitoidrocks(lowerPaleocene)—Granodioriteandquartzmonzonitestocks.
Locallyassociatedwithmineralization.
Datedat58,58,59,59,60,62,and64m.
y.
TKpPorphyriticandapliticintrusiverocks(PaleoceneandUpperCretaceous)—Mostlylatiticporphyrytodaciticporphyryinsmallstocksandplugsandapliticbodiesnotassociatedwithothergranitoidstocks.
Datedat61,63,63,64,and65m.
y.
KdDioriteandquartzdiorite(UpperCretaceous)—Stocksofdark-grayfine-tomedium-grainedrocks.
Locallyassociatedwithmineralization.
Datedat67and67m.
y.
KqQuartzmonzonite(UpperCretaceous)—Stocksofpinkish-graymedium-grainedrock.
Datedat68,69,and70m.
y.
KgGranodiorite(UpperCretaceous)—Stocksofgray,medium-grained,locallyporphyriticrock.
Datedat68m.
y.
KusUppersedimentaryrocks(UpperCretaceous)—Mainlyconglomerateandsandstone;includessometuffaceousrocks.
Thicknessasmuchasseveralhundredsofmeters.
KrRhyodacitetuffandweldedtuff(UpperCretaceous)—IncludespartsofSaleroFormation,SugarloafQuartzLatite,andBroncoVolcanics,andallofRedBoyRhyolite,CatMountainRhyoliteofBrown(1939)andUncleSamPorphyry.
Includeslocalintrusivebodiesandlocallycontainsfragmentsofexoticrocks.
Thicknesscommonlyseveraltensofmeterstoseveralhundredsofmeters.
Datedat66(),70,72,72,73,and73m.
y.
KaAndesitictodaciticvolcanicbreccia(UpperCretaceous)—IncludespartsofSaleroFormation,SugarloafQuartzLatite,andBroncoVolcanics,andallofDemetrieVolcanicsandSilverbellFormationofCourtright(1958).
Commonlycontainslargeblocksofexoticrocksandlocallyincludessomesedimentaryrocksandintrusiverocks.
Severaltensofmeterstoseveralhundredsofmetersthickinmostplaces.
KuvsVolcanicandsedimentaryrocks,undifferentiated(UpperCretaceous)—Mainlyandesitictorhyoliticpyroclasticrocks,andepiclasticrocks.
Commonlyseveraltensofmeterstoseveralhundredsofmetersthick.
KlqLowerquartzmonzoniteandgranodiorite(UpperCretaceous)—includessomequartzdiorite;appearsinsmallstocks.
Locallyassociatedwithmineralization.
Datedat70,71,72,73,74,74,74,and76m.
y.
KsSedimentaryrocks(UpperCretaceous)—IncludesFortCrittendenFormationandformationnearJavelinaCanyonofEpis(1956).
Mainlyconglomerate,sandstone,8andsiltstone;includessomeredbeds,fossiliferousblackshale,andtuffaceousrocks.
Thicknessseveraltenstoseveralhundredsofmeters.
KiRhyodaciteporphyry(UpperandLowerCretaceous)—Mainlystocks,sills,andsomedikesbutpossiblyincludessometuffs.
Someoftherocksmaybeasyoungasrhyodacitetuffandweldedtuff.
IGNEOUSANDSEDIMENTARYROCKSKbBisbeeFormationorGroup,undifferentiated(LowerCretaceous)KbuUpperpartofBisbeeFormationorGroup,undifferentiated,andrelatedrocks—includesupperpartofBisbeeFormation,MuralLimestone,Morita,Cintura,WillowCanyon,ApacheCanyon,ShellenbergerCanyonandTurneyRanchFormations(notlistedinstratigraphicsequence)oftheBisbeeGroup,ArmoleArkoseofBryantandKinnison(1954),andAngelicArkose.
Consistsofbrownish-toreddish-grayarkose,siltstone,sandstone,conglomerate,andsomefossiliferousgraylimestone.
Commonlyseveralhundredmetersthick.
KbgGlanceConglomerateofBisbeeGroup,orGlanceConglomerateMemberofBisbeeFormation—Typicallylimestone-pebble-andcobbleconglomerate;locallygraniteorschistconglomerate.
Mostlylessthan10metersthick;locallyseveralhundredsofmetersthick.
KlvsLowervolcanicandsedimentaryrocks(LowerCretaceous)—Andesitictorhyoliticvolcanicrocks,conglomerate,andsandstone.
Asmuchasseveralhundredsofmetersthick.
JgGraniteandquartzmonzonite(Jurassic)—Stocksofpinkish-graycoarse-grainedrock.
Locallyassociatedwithmineralization.
Datedat140,148,148,149,149,150,153,160,161,167,178,and185m.
y.
J^iIntrusiverocks(JurassicandTriassic)—Rhyoliticporphyryplutons,dikes,andsills.
J^vsVolcanicandsedimentaryrocks(JurassicandTriassic)—Rhyolitictuff,weldedtuff,lava,sandstone,andconglomerate.
Asmuchasseveralhundredsofmetersthick.
Datedat143and173m.
y.
^mMonzoniticrocks(Triassic)—Stocksofdark-grayverycoarse-grainedmonzoniteandquartzmonzonite.
Datedat184,190,and210m.
y.
^sSedimentaryrocks(Triassic)—Redmudstone,sandstone,andconglomerate,andintercalatedrhyodacitevolcanicrocks.
Asmuchasseveralhundredsofmetersthick.
Datedat192m.
y.
9^vsVolcanicandsedimentaryrocks(Triassic)—Rhyolitictoandesiticlavaandpyroclasticrocksandintercalatedsandstone,quartzite,andsomeconglomerate.
Asmuchas3000metersthick.
Datedat220m.
y.
|sSedimentaryrocks(Paleozoic)—RainvalleyFormation(LowerPermian)toBolsaQuartzite(MiddleCambrian),undifferentiated.
P*nNacoGroup(LowerPermianandPennsylvanian)—RainvalleyFormation,ConchaLimestone,ScherrerFormation,EpitaphDolomite,ColinaLimestone,EarpFormation,andHorquillaLimestone,undifferentiated.
PsSedimentaryrocks(LowerPermian)—ConsistsofRainvalleyFormation,ConchaLimestone,andScherrerFormation,undifferentiated.
RainvalleyFormationisasparselyfossiliferouslimestone,dolomite,andsomesandstone,90-120metersthick.
ConchaLimestoneisdark-gray,cherty,fossiliferouslimestone,120-180metersthick.
ScherrerFormationisalight-pinkish-grayfine-grainedquartzitewithsomebasalreddish-graysiltstoneandamedialgraydolomiteunit240-310metersthick.
P*sSedimentaryrocks(LowerPermianandUpperPennsylvanian)—ConsistsofEpitaphDolomite(LowerPermian),ColinaLimestone(LowerPermian),andEarpFormation(LowerPermianandUpperPennsylvanian),undifferentiated.
EpitaphDolomiteisadark-tolight-grayslightlychertydolomite,limestone,marl,siltstone,andgypsum,120-280metersthick.
ColinaLimestoneisamedium-gray,thick-bedded,sparselycherty,andsparselyfossiliferouslimestone120-280metersthick.
EarpFormationisapale-redsiltstone,mudstone,shale,andlimestone,120-240metersthick.
*hHorquillaLimestone(UpperandMiddlePennsylvanian)—Light-pinkish-gray,thick-tothin-bedded,cherty,fossiliferouslimestoneandintercalatedpalebrowntopalereddish-graysiltstonethatincreasesinabundanceupward.
Typically300-490metersthick.
MDsSedimentaryrocks(MississippianandDevonian)—ConsistsmainlyofEscabrosaLimestone(Mississippian)—locally(ArmstrongandSilberman,1974)calledEscabrosaGroup—andMartinFormation(UpperDevonian),undifferentiated.
InpartoftheChiricahuaMountainsalsoincludesParadiseFormation(UpperMississippian)andPortalFormationofSabins,1957a(UpperDevonian).
IntheLittleDragoonMountainsandsomeadjacenthillsalsoincludesBlackPrinceLimestone,whosefaunaandcorrelationshowstrongestaffinitieswithMississippianrocksbutwhichmayincludesomePennsylvanianrocks.
EscabrosaLimestoneisamedium-gray,massivetothick-bedded,commonlycrinoidal,cherty,fossiliferouslimestone90-310metersthick.
MartinFormationisthick-tothin-bedded,graytobrowndolomite,graysparselyfossiliferouslimestone,andsomesiltstoneandsandstone,90-120metersthick.
ParadiseFormationisabrown,fossiliferous,shalylimestone.
PortalFormationisablackshaleand10limestone60-105metersthick.
BlackPrinceLimestoneisapinkish-graylimestonewithabasalshaleandchertconglomerate,asmuchas52metersthick.
O_sElPasoLimestone(LowerOrdovicianandUpperCambrian),AbrigoFormation(UpperandMiddleCambrian),andBolsaQuartz(MiddleCambrian),undifferentiated—ElPasoLimestoneisagray,thin-beddedchertylimestoneanddolomite90meterstoabout220metersthick.
AbrigoFormationisabrown,thin-beddedfossiliferouslimestone,sandstone,quartzite,andshale,210-240metersthick.
BolsaQuartziteisabrowntowhiteorpurplish-gray,thick-bedded,coarse-grainedquartziteandsandstonewithabasalconglomerate,90-180metersthick.
Totheeast,equivalentsofpartoftheAbrigoFormationandBolsaQuartziteareknownastheCoronadoSandstone.
_sSedimentaryrocks(UpperandMiddleCambrian)—AbrigoFormation(UpperandMiddleCambrian),andBolsaQuartzite(MiddleCambrian),undifferentiated.
YdDiabase(PrecambrianY)—Includesmetadiabase,insills,dikes,andpossiblyasmallpluton.
YaApacheGroup(PrecambrianY)—MainlyDrippingSpringFormationandPioneerFormation.
DrippingSpringFormationisapaletodark-brownarkosicsandstoneandquartzite,asmuchas90metersthick.
BarnesConglomerateMemberlocallyatbaseofDrippingSpringisaround-pebbleconglomeratewithclastsofquartziteandjasper,asmuchas5metersthick.
PioneerFormationisagrayish-redtopurplish-graysiltstoneandmudstone,asmuchas90metersthick.
ScanlanConglomerateMemberlocallyatbaseofPioneerisasubangular-pebbleconglomeratewithclastsofgranitoidrocksandveinquartz.
Memberisasmuchas10metersthick.
YgMainlygranodioriteandquartzmonzonite(PrecambrianY)—Unfoliatedtofoliated,inpartmetamorphosed.
Generallyinstocks,whichhavebeenlittlestudied.
YwWrongMountainQuartzMonzonite(PrecambrianY)—A2-micagneissicrockthermallymetamorphosedduringtheOligoceneandpossiblyrelatedtoaPaleocenemagmaticevent,butwithrelictsofPrecambrian()agerecordedlocally.
YrRinconValleyGranodiorite(PrecambrianY)—Typicallyunfoliatedbiotitegranodioriteandlocallyhornblende-biotitegranodiorite.
Datedat1450,1540,and1560m.
y.
YcContinentalGranodiorite(PrecambrianY)—Verycoarselyporphyriticgranodiorite,metagranodiorite,andgneissicgranodiorite,possiblyofbatholithic-sizedbodies.
Datedas1360and1450m.
y.
,andpossiblyslightlyolder.
YtTungstenKingGranite(PrecambrianY)—Coarse-grainedporphyriticbiotitegranite.
11XjJohnnyLyonGranodiorite(PrecambrianY)—Commonlyanaltered,massive,hornblende-biotitegranodiorite;locallyabiotitegranodioriteandlocallymetamorphosed.
Datedat1630m.
y.
XpPinalSchist(PrecambrianX)—Chloriteschist,phyllite,andsomemetavolcanicrocks,metaquartzite,metaquartziteconglomerate,andgneiss.
Onemetavolcanicrockdatedat1715m.
y.
XiRhyoliteporphyry(PrecambrianX)—Stocksandintrusivesheets;mainlyolderthanregionalmetamorphismbutsomesheetsyoungerthanmetamorphism.
DataSources,Processing,andAccuracyOptronicsSpecialtyCo.
,Inc.
(Northridge,CA)scannedcontactsandfaultsfromthepublishedpapermapsbyDrewes(1980)undercontracttotheU.
S.
GeologicalSurveyin2000and2001.
Becauseneitheroriginalmylarsnorunfoldedmapswereavailable,foldedmapswerepressedwithadryironpriortobeingscanned.
ContractorsattheSpokaneFieldOfficedevelopedaregistrationticfilefromtheoriginalmapsheets(Drewes,1980)andtransformedthedata(AppendixB).
Thespatialdigitaldatabaseinversion2.
0containsrevisionstotheversion1.
0database,newGISfortheeasthalfoftheDrewes(1980)tectonicmapsandadditionaldatasuchasstructuralattitudeofbedding,foliation,lineationandfaultplanes,rocksamplecollectionsites,markerbedsandgeomorphicfeaturedata.
U.
S.
GeologicalSurveystaffandcontractorseditedthespatialandattributedata,standardizedthedatabase,andcomparedplotsofthedatabasewiththeoriginalpublishedmapstoidentifyandcorrectdigitizingandattributionerrors.
Inafewinstances,mapunitswithaverysmallarealextenthadtobeinterpretedsincetheycouldnotbeconclusivelyidentifiedontheoriginalmap.
Duetothecartographicnatureoflinedecorationsontheoriginalmap,segmentsofparticularfaultshadtobeinterpretedastowhereagivenfaulttypestartedandended.
FaultlinesontheDrewes(1980)mapthatweredecoratedwithaballandbarandnodiparrowwereattributedasfaultswithnormalmovement.
Afewbeddingsymbolsdidnothaveadipvalueandwereexcludedfromthedatabase.
FinalprocessingattheUSGeologicalSurveywasdoneinArcInfo(version7.
2.
1)installedonSunUltraandMicrosoftNTworkstations.
Theoverallaccuracy(withrespecttothelocationoflines,pointsandpolygons)ofthedigitalgeologicmapisprobablynobetterthan±187meters.
Thisdatabaseshouldnotbeusedordisplayedatanyscalelargerthan1:125,000(forexample,1:100,000or1:24,000).

21StructuralmapsymbolsdatasetDescriptionsofitemsinthegeologicmapsymbolspointattributetable,i1109sdp.
pat,areasfollows:i1109sdp.
patITEMNAMEITEMTYPEITEMWIDTHATTRIBUTEDESCRIPTIONpttypecharacter50Thetypeofpointfeatureobservationdisplayedonthemap,forexample,faultattitudeindicator,foldplunge,inclined,horizontalorverticalbedding,inclinedorverticalfoliation,lineation.
symbolinteger3MarkersymbolnumberusedbyArcInfotoidentifytypeofgeologicmapsymbol.
Symbolnumbersrefertothescamp2d.
mrkmarkerset(afterMattiandothers,1997).
strikeinteger3Strikeofbedding,fault,foliationorotherstructuralplane;bearingoflineation;ordirectionofplunge.
Thevalueinstrikeisanazimuthalangle(measuredindegreesfrom0to360inaclockwisedirectionfromnorth).
Thevaluein"strike"isapproximate,becauseitwascalculatedbydigitizingthecartographicsymbolfromthemap.
dipinteger3Dipofbedding,fault,foldplunge,foliationorlineation.
Thisvalueisananglemeasured(indegreesfrom0to90)downfromthehorizontal;thusahorizontaldipis0degreeandaverticaldipis90degrees.
ai_anginteger3Aninterimvalueusedtocalculatesym$angle.
Thevariousstructuralmapsymbolsinthescamp2d.
mrkmarkerset(Mattiandothers,1997)hadtoberotatedbydifferentamountstoachievetheirpropermaporientation.
Forthestrikeanddipsymbols,ai_ang=strike–270.
sym$anginteger3Theangleusedtocompletethemathematicalrotationofthestructuralmapsymboltoitsproperorientationonthemap.
Thisvalueisthe$anglepseudoitemvalueforthepoint.

gov/i-map/i1109/Data_Quality_Information:Attribute_Accuracy:Attribute_Accuracy_Report:Accuracywasverifiedbymanualcomparisonofthesourcewithhardcopyplotsandprintouts.
Someinterpretationoftheoriginaldatawasnecessarywhenmapareascoveredaverysmallarealextent,hadnolabelsandwererepresentedwithsimilarcolorhues.
Insomecasesthedecorationsforfaultsontheoriginalmapmadeitdifficulttodeterminewhereaparticulartypeoffaultstartedandstopped.
Numericalvaluesforstrikeshouldbeconsideredapproximatebecausetheyweredigitizedfromthesourcemapandnottakenfromfieldnotes.
Theitem"strike"alsorepresentslineationbearingandplungedirectiontosimplifythedatabase.
Strikesymbolsweredigitizedusingtheright-handruleandthestrikedirectionwascalculatedmathematically.
Dipvaluesinthedatabaserepresentthedipvalueannotatedontheoriginalmap.
Logical_Consistency_Report:Polygonandchain-nodetopologyispresent.
Polygonsintersectingtheneatlineareclosedalongtheborder.
Segmentsmakinguptheouterandinnerboundariesofapolygontieend-to-endtocompletelyenclosethearea.
Polygonsliversandlinedangleswereremoved.
Linesegmentsareasetofsequentiallynumberedcoordinatepairs.
Noduplicatefeaturesorduplicatepointsexistinadatastring.
Intersectinglinesareseparatedintoindividuallinesegmentsatthepointofintersection.
Pointdataarerepresentedbytwosetsofcoordinatepairs,eachwiththesamecoordinatevalues.
Allnodesarerepresentedbyasinglecoordinatepairindicatingthebeginningorendofalinesegment.
Theneatlinewasgeneratedbymathematicallygeneratingthefoursidesofthequadrangle,densifyingthelinesoflatitudeandprojectingthefiletoTransverseprojection(shownasUTM12).
Completeness_Report:AllgeologicunitswerecapturedfromDrewes(1980)atascaleof1:125,000.
Fourconcealedcontactlinesinthe"Qg"alluviummapunitinthenorthwestpartofthemapwereexcludedfromthedatabase.
Theoriginalmapalsohadtwopointswitha"Qg"mapunitlabelandnocorrespondingcontactrepresentingtheextentofthemapunit.
Theselabelswereexcludedfromthedatabase.
Threeconcealedmapunitareaslabeled"Klq"ontheoriginalwestsheetwereprintedwithacolorrepresentingthe"QTgu"mapunit.
Thisdatabaseshowsthesethreeareaswiththegreen"Klq"colorassignedtothismapunit.
ThreelineslocatedintheYwandYcmapunitinthenorthernpartofthewestsheetwereundefinedinthemapexplanationandwereexcludedfromthisdatabase.
HachuredlinesrepresentingbeachridgesintheQpmapunitalongthemarginsoftheWilcoxPlayawerenotincludedinthedatabase.
Welllocation,mapunitspenetratedandcorrespondingthicknessdataalsowerenotincludedinthisdatabase.
